Imma recommend some of my faves which would match to your already chosen products and skin needs, hope it gives some inspiration! (For the Am routine there is a milder cleanser needed, if not only rinsing with water should be enough) Vitamin C is awesome paired with hyaluronic acid,they complement each other and result in a powerful anti-aging pair to provide magnificent and long term benefits in the skin's appearance and battling against earlier signs of aging. To be honest… I like to use oil infused micellar water because it basically works better for my skin which tends to be oily on some parts/pores clog.

Honestly, my skin hates cerave. My sister has normal skin, no acne etc, but even for her cerave was bad experience. She started getting little bums on her cheeks because of cerave moisturizer. When it comes to clinique,it depends on your budget ofc, but i would not recommend wasting your money on something that is just okay. I have oily skin, so it would be hard for me to actually be helpful with finding another moisturizer, but generally speaking, korean ones are good and affordable. Also, i would recomend using AcneClinic web to check whether your moisturizer has potentially clogging ingridients, to avoid wasting your money on smth that will end up giving you small bumps. Really like the serum that you chose! The best one i have tried so far, very simple, affordable and does the job. Not a fan of the sunscreen tho. I will add the cleansing oil that i have heard so much about. Really want to try it out soon, becase it does not have much pore clogging ingredients. Good luck!❤️
